@@raynic1173 Well Buell is back!!! Albeit without Eric Buell but still it's great that it's back, I'll be the first in line to get one, my XB9 would eat my CBR929RR alive on the winding mountain roads where I live, if that CBR didn't have some long straightaways to wind up on it didn't have a chance against the Buell, it's the best handling bike I've ever ridden. When I got my CBR I rode it exclusively for the first two weeks I had it without touching any of my other bikes, at the end of those two weeks judging by the way it handled I figured it had to be 10% heavier than the Buell just by the way it felt, when I looked up their weights I was shocked to find out that the CBR only weighed 4 lbs more than the XB, but when you park the two next to each other and thought about it it made sense, instead of having all the weight of the fuel up high like a traditional arrangement it was in the frame down much lower, the engine oil is in the swingarm and the muffler is down underneath the engine instead of up high from an upswept exhaust system, the center of gravity was down much lower from those things which led to a bike that handled like no other I've ever ridden, Eric Buell is a genius.
